## Test plan — Inkpress PDF invoice renderer

Quick rundown for the render pass: check multi-page invoices, long line-item names that wrap, zero-amount credits, and the euro/yen symbol cases. Compare output against the golden PDFs in the fixtures folder — pixel diffs under 0.5% pass.

The render endpoint on staging needs auth, so use the bearer token below.

session JWT of yawep-yawep = eyJhbGciOiJIUzI1NiIsInR5cCI6IkpXVCJ9.eyJzdWIiOiI3pWF3_In0.aXYsHiog

Handover note — Marlowe partner SFTP drop (for weekly eng sync)

The nightly drop from Verlan Logistics lands in the ingest bucket after the 02:10 pull. Files are PGP-encrypted; the decrypt step runs on the Ostrey worker and retries three times before paging. Note that Verlan occasionally uploads zero-byte placeholders — the validator now skips these silently rather than alerting. Please verify the schedule against the connection settings included directly below.

deployment values, yadug-bawif:
[framir]
team = pelox
access_code = ac_a38ab2
owner = tamion.julael
host = framir.tolvaqlabs.test
port = 11211
peer = tammir.zemvargrid.local
salt = 2215ef03
pin = 1541

Runbook — Pellwright CSV Import Wizard. New teammates: always run imports against the staging tenant first. Check that delimiter detection matches the preview pane, and that rejected rows land in the quarantine bucket. If the wizard hangs past step three, restart the parser pod. Log the active build token below before escalating.

pipeline stamp: htk31_f769b577b3028a4e9958e5bb8d1259a